A Step-by-Step Guide to Achieving Emotional Freedom through Debt Consolidation

The journey to emotional liberation via debt consolidation begins with a clear understanding of the steps involved. Initially, it may appear intimidating, but by breaking the process down into manageable tasks, you can alleviate distress. Start by compiling all relevant financial details, including outstanding debts, interest rates, and payment schedules. This transparency is essential for identifying the most effective consolidation strategy tailored to your unique circumstances.

Next, assess various consolidation options, such as personal loans, balance transfer credit cards, or debt management plans. Each choice comes with distinct benefits and consequences, and carefully evaluating these factors empowers you to make informed decisions. As you embark on this transformative journey, remember that seeking professional guidance can be invaluable in ensuring you choose the best course of action.

Once you’ve settled on a consolidation strategy, the emotional benefits will begin to unfold. The process itself can act as a catalyst for change, instilling hope and a renewed sense of control over your financial situation. As you make progress in consolidating your debt, you may find your emotional resilience grows, paving the way for a brighter financial future.

Navigating the Impact on Credit Scores: Understanding Emotional Repercussions of Credit Changes

Concerns regarding how debt consolidation might affect credit scores are common and can induce significant emotional distress. While it is true that consolidating debt may initially influence your credit score, it’s essential to recognize the long-term benefits. Responsible management of consolidated debt can lead to improved credit health over time.

Educating yourself about the mechanics of credit scores can help demystify the process. Understanding that consolidation can ultimately result in lower credit utilization and better payment history can shift your focus from immediate worries to future advantages. This awareness can alleviate the emotional burden associated with credit score changes, allowing you to approach debt consolidation with confidence.

Addressing Common Questions About the Emotional Advantages of Debt Consolidation

Can Debt Consolidation Truly Improve My Mood?

Absolutely, debt consolidation can significantly enhance your mood by relieving anxiety and stress related to managing multiple debts. Streamlining payments usually leads to a greater sense of control and tranquility.

When Can I Expect to Experience Emotional Benefits?

The emotional benefits of debt consolidation can typically be felt within weeks of implementing a plan, as the clarity and simplicity of a single payment can drastically lower stress levels.

What Should I Do If I Continue to Face Emotional Challenges After Consolidation?

If you find yourself struggling with emotional difficulties after consolidation, seeking professional help can be beneficial. A financial advisor or therapist can provide support and strategies for managing ongoing emotional challenges.

Is Debt Consolidation Right for Everyone?

While debt consolidation can provide substantial emotional and financial relief for many, it may not be suitable for everyone. Evaluate your individual financial circumstances and consider consulting a professional for personalized guidance.

Will My Credit Score Be Affected After Consolidation?

Consolidating debt may initially impact your credit score; however, responsible management of your consolidated debt can lead to improved credit health over time.

How Can I Choose the Ideal Debt Consolidation Strategy?

Choosing the best debt consolidation strategy necessitates assessing your financial situation, understanding your emotional needs, and researching options that align with your objectives.

Can I Consolidate Debts Without Impacting My Credit Score?

While some forms of consolidation may affect your credit, exploring options like debt management plans can facilitate consolidation without significant credit score consequences.

What If I Have Both Secured and Unsecured Debt?

Combining secured and unsecured debt into a consolidation strategy is possible; however, it’s important to understand the implications and seek advice from a financial professional.

How Often Should I Review My Debt Consolidation Strategy?

Regularly reviewing your debt consolidation strategy, ideally every six months, can help keep you on track, make necessary adjustments, and ensure you maximize emotional benefits.

Are There Any Risks Associated with Debt Consolidation?

While debt consolidation can provide emotional and financial relief, risks include potentially accruing more debt if spending habits do not change. It’s vital to adopt a responsible approach to financial management.
